Research Abstract |
The aim of this project was the development of two kinds of new application of robotics either which is useful for the bone fracture curing practice. One is the stimulating device to accelerating the curing of fractured bone. Two is the measurement device of stiffness of fractured bone to know the healing stage. Animals for experiments were rabbits. The investigators fixed them on the fixation table and fed them in the all period of experiments. The left leg of rabbit was fractured by surgical operation. The leg received indtermittent stimulation applied to the fracture site during the healing period. A robot was used to apply this stimulation. Two robot were also used for apparatus to meausre the healing speed of the fracture; one of these applied micro rotation to the rabbit ankle and the other was used to grip the gap sensor. This enable the stiffness of the fractured leg to be determined. The investigators measured the stiffness three times at once to estimate the reproducibility. And measurements were done once three days in the healing period. The results obtained here were as follows. First, stimulation of rotation on the bone fracture site was dangerous for healing. Bending was either dangerous. Secondly, stimulation of compression was useful for healing but not so large effect because no stimulation didn't inhibit the healing same as compression. Thirdly, the reproducibility of the measurements of the stiffness of the fractured bone using the robot arm for the device in vivo was sufficiently high.
